My Brother Sam is Dead by James Collier

MY BROTHER SAM IS DEAD is a great book about the Revolutionary War. It is exciting, sad, and interesting. It’s about a family whose sixteen year old son joins the war. While he’s away, many awful things happen to the family. The father is killed by raiders and some of the twelve year old son’s friends are killed by the British. My favorite part was when the older brother came home and butchered the family cow for a meal and was punished. Find out what else happens by reading this great book!
